Pouilly-Fuissé is the source of the greatest wines of the Mâconnais, a bit like Puligny-Montrachet and its Grand Crus for the Côte-d'Or. Vergisson's 1er Cru site Sur La Roche, steep and with a wafer-thin layer of humus on a limestone cliff, facing south-east, lies high up on the slope, but above it towers Le Haut de la Roche, on the same terroir in the same exposure. Exactly, we too initially asked ourselves which was better, to be at the top or a little further down the hill. Did you come to the same conclusion as we did? The higher up the cooler, the cooler the better, now that climate change is a fact. We found Le Haut de la Roche to be much more agile, there was more energy, the wine was clearer and even more to the point. It is wonderful how it smells of white flowers and how elegantly and subtly pears and orange notes mingle with it, how a fine nutty component gives the bouquet an almost infinite depth. The feeling on the palate is wonderful, elegance that combines perfectly with power and makes it clear that there is something big in the glass here, a wine with lively acidity, one that makes you salivate in unimaginable quantities.
